    The Power of Symbols in the UK Brewing Industry

    The beer and brewing industry in the UK has long relied on symbols—be it crests, colours, or emblems—to convey quality, tradition, and social identity. This visual language is especially prominent in the segment of light beers, which often target health-conscious consumers while aspiring to maintain a connection to traditional brewing roots.

    For instance, brands such as Carling and Foster’s utilize logos that evoke a sense of heritage and trustworthiness, employing symbols that resonate strongly within the collective cultural consciousness. But beyond the primary branding, ancillary symbols—like the faint motifs of glasses, hops, or light rays—add layers of meaning that can influence consumer perception.

    The Cultural Context of Beer Logos in the UK

    UK’s beer branding is not merely about aesthetics; it reflects historical narratives, regional identities, and social rituals. Symbols embedded in logos act as visual shortcuts that evoke a sense of familiarity and trustworthiness.

    For light beers, which often position themselves as a modern, health-aware alternative, the choice of symbols can influence their acceptance among younger demographics, health-conscious consumers, and traditional beer drinkers alike. The integration of symbols that suggest vitality and lightness—like sun motifs or airy fonts—are strategic choices grounded in cultural symbolism.
